The Best of Roman Algeria tour will take you to explore ancient Punic and Roman cities, enjoy some of Algeria’s finest museums, and discover historic sites in Algiers.

After breakfast, you will spend the morning visiting the archaeological site of Hippo, the museum, and the Cathedral of St. Augustine. St. Augustine was bishop in Hippo from 395-430 AD and you can still see the remains of the ‘Basilica of Peace’ where he preached many sermons.

In the morning, you will travel to Guelma and see the best preserved Roman amphitheatre in Algeria. There are small museums to explore. Be sure to stop at the Hammam Maskhoutine, which is a multicolored ‘waterfall’ spring that has formed from the natural hot spring.
When you are ready travel south to the hillside archeological site of Khemissa. See the theature and layout of this ancient Roman town. Travel to Constantine for night.

After breakfat you’ll begin the day with a trip to the archaeological hillside Roman site of Tiddis, which offers excellent views over the region. You will begin by walking through the Arch of Memmius and to the sanctuary of Mithras, Christian basilica, and Roman houses.
Return to Constantine for a half day tour enjoying this breath-taking city. You will explore the suspension bridges, the Constantine museum, Kasbah, and Palace of Ahmed Bey.

Today you will want to depart early to have sufficient time at all the sites. Begin with a stop at Medracen (Ancient Numidian Tomb), which is 58 meters in diameter and 19 meters tall. Then travel to the UNESCO site of Timgad, begun by Emperor Trajan in AD100, where you will discover the library, temples, amphitheater, arch of Trajan, forum, houses, and basilicas. There is a fantastic museum at the site with grand mosaics found in the region.
On your return to Lambaesis, you will stop to visit the large ancient Roman legionary base. Continue to Batna for night.

After breakfast travel north to to the UNESCO World Heritage site of Djemila meaning ‘Beautiful’ in Arabic. The site lives up to its name as it is uniquely situated amongst rolling hills. You will have a guided visit of both the museum and the historic site. Explore the forum, basilicas, baptisteries, arch of Caracalla, Temple des Septimes, well-preserved Roman market, and theatre.
Continue to Setif and upon arrival explore the Setif archaeological museum with the grand mosaic of the ‘Triumph of Dionysos.’
